> To all Palm OS developers,
>
> I am planning to start an open source development project for a Palm OS
> DivX/Xvid player. Because there is only 1 player for the palm (mmplayer)
and
> it isn't free time has come to make an open source player.
>
> The Pocket PC platform for example has several DivX/Xvid capable players
> (BetaPlayer & PocketMPV). A lot of people chose Pocket PC's for their
> multimedia capebilities. To help Palm OS through this we need to provide
the
> same facilities and features but better.
> By using the source code of the two open source players for the Pocket PC
> platform we could have a easy start building one. (BUT the project goal is
> not to port a player from the Pocket PC platform but to develop a new
one!)
>
> Wouldn't it be great to have a good working, free Palm OS DivX/Xvid
player.
> In this time of multimedia it is the future of the handhelds and time has
> come to make Palm OS ready for it!
>
> Anyone with me who would like to help developing? Please reply and tell me
> you are going to help with the development and make Palm OS ready for the
> next 10 years!
